ATX Technologies Inc. is headquartered in Irving, TX. ATX is a pioneer and growth company in the emerging telematics industry. Competing primarily with On Star, ATX is a market leader bringing wireless technology together with GPS and the vehicle to provide automobile safety, security, information, and mobile commerce services to automotive manufacturers (Mercedes-Benz, Jaguar, BMW, Infinity, etc.) and their customers.
